+#+TITLE: numap
+
+Print the NUMA topology of a host.
+
+* Usage
+#+BEGIN_SRC sh
+./numap |jq .
+{
+  "node0": {
+    "name": "node0",
+    "path": "/sys/devices/system/node/node0",
+    "cpulist": "0-19,40-59",
+    "pci_devices": [
+      {
+        "vendor": "Mellanox Technologies",
+        "name": "MT27710 Family [ConnectX-4 Lx]"
+      },
+      {
+        "vendor": "Mellanox Technologies",
+        "name": "MT27710 Family [ConnectX-4 Lx]"
+      }
+    ]
+  },
+  "node1": {
+    "name": "node1",
+    "path": "/sys/devices/system/node/node1",
+    "cpulist": "20-39,60-79",
+    "pci_devices": [
+      {
+        "vendor": "Intel Corporation",
+        "name": "NVMe Datacenter SSD [3DNAND, Beta Rock Controller]"
+      }
+    ]
+  }
+}
+#+END_SRC
+
+The command will scan the host to find the NUMA nodes, and all the PCI devices, and map the PCI devices back to the NUMA node.
+
+It also provides a way to see the list of CPUs attached to the node.
+
+* Limitations
+** Device class
+For now only the following classes of hardware are cared for:
+- NVMe
+- network
+- GPU
